-
PHP获取当前网站域名和地址的代码
本文是一个PHP获取当前网站域名和地址的代码,从phpmyadmin中提取的函数,感兴趣的同学参考下. <? function PMA_getenv($var_name) { if (isset($_SERVER[$var_name])) { return $_SERVER[$var_name]; } elseif (isset($_ENV[$var_name])) { return $_ENV[$var_name]; } elseif (getenv($var_name)) { return getenv($var_name); } elseif (function_exists('apache_getenv') && apache_getenv($var_name, true)) { return apache_getenv($var_name, true); } return ''; } if (empty($HTTP_HOST)) { if (PMA_getenv('HTTP_...
PHP 2014-12-13 06:39:03 -
php cookie 作用范围–不要在当前页面使用你的cookie
本文为大家讲解的是php的cookie的作用范围,并解释了在当前页面写入的cookie在当前页面是读取不到的,感兴趣的同学参考下. 背景: 这两天在调试bug的时候遇到了一个问题,就是页面莫名其妙的会跳转到登陆页面 因为在本地测试完全没有问题,所以ssh到远程服务器上(不是发布服务器,建议不要直接在Publish Server上直接改东西),进行了一下断点的测试,最后发现是一个比较复杂的逻辑中有个函数在构造函数中调用了登陆验证。没有验证通过所以就跳走了...
PHP 2014-12-13 04:51:05 -
PHP获取当前文件所在目录 getcwd()函数
本文为大家介绍了二种PHP 获取当前目录的方法。用 getcwd() 函数或 dirname(__FILE__),感兴趣的同学参考下. <?php echo getcwd() . "<br/>"; echo dirname(__FILE__); ?>...
PHP 2014-12-12 08:42:11 -
php 获取当前访问的url文件名的方法小结
本文是一个php实现的可能用来获取当前访问的url中的文件名的方法,感兴趣的同学参考下。 推荐函数: 一是PHP获取当前页面的网址: dedecms也是用的这个 //获得当前的脚本网址 function GetCurUrl() { if(!empty($_SERVER["REQUEST_URI"])) { $scriptName = $_SERVER["REQUEST_URI"]; $nowurl = $scriptName; } else { $scriptName = $_SERVER["PHP_SELF"]; if(empty($_SERVER["QUERY_STRING"])) { $nowurl = $scriptName; } else { $nowurl = $scriptName."?".$_SERVER["QUERY_STRING"]; } } return $nowurl; } 方法...
PHP 2014-12-08 08:00:07 -
PHP获取当前页面URL方法
本文是一个PHP实现可以用来获取当前页面URL的函数实例代码,讲述了一个非常简单实用的获取当前页面URL的函数,并附带说明了server参数的用法,需要的朋友可以参考下 在PHP中,没有默认的Function来获取目前所在页面的URL,所以今天就向大家介绍一个在PHP获取当前页面完整URL的PHP函数. 函数代码如下,调用时只需要使用 curPageURL() 就行啦: /* 获得当前页面URL开始 */ function curPageURL() { $pageURL = 'http'; if ($_SERVER["HTTPS"] == "on") { // 如果是SSL加密则加上“s” $pageURL ...
PHP 2014-12-08 06:48:06 -
php获取当前网址url并替换参数或网址的方法
本文是一个php获取当前网址url并替换参数或网址的方法,感兴趣的同学参考下。 //获得当前的脚本网址 function GetCurUrl() { if(!empty($_SERVER["REQUEST_URI"])) { $scriptName = $_SERVER["REQUEST_URI"]; $nowurl = $scriptName; } else { $scriptName = $_SERVER["PHP_SELF"]; if(empty($_SERVER["QUERY_STRING"])) { $nowurl = $scriptName; } else { $nowurl = $scriptName."?".$_SERVER["QUERY_STRING"]; } } return $nowurl; } 另一个是PHP替换网址中query部分的某变量的值比如 ,我们要设$url中的key=32...
PHP 2014-12-03 01:14:09 -
使用PHP获取当前url路径的函数以及服务器变量示例代码
本文是一个使用PHP获取当前url路径的函数以及服务器变量示例代码,感兴趣的同学参考下。 PHP获取当前url路径的函数及服务器变量: 代码: <?php $path = /usr/opt/../ect/abcd; echo $_SERVER['DOCUMENT_ROOT']."<br>"; //获得服务器文档根变量(取决于http.conf中的配置) echo $_SERVER['PHP_SELF']."<br>"; //获得执行该代码的文件的路径,与http.conf中的配置有关系...
PHP 2014-12-02 21:11:59 -
php使用mysql_fetch_array()获取当前行数据的方法详解
本文为大家讲解的是php使用mysql_fetch_array()获取当前行数据的方法详解,感兴趣的同学参考下。 同mysql_fetch_row()类似,函数mysql_fetch_array()也是获取结果集中当前行数据,并在调用后自动滑向下一行...
PHP 2014-12-02 21:02:57 -
php中用date函数获取当前时间有误的解决办法(8小时时差)
本文为大家讲解的是php中用date函数获取当前时间有误的解决办法(8小时时差),感兴趣的同学参考下。 初学PHP做网站,想在页面上获得当前时间,学过编程的人都知道用时间函数date(),先用这个函数格式化一个本地时间/日期,先写个测试代码吧,结果输出时间比实际时间少了8小时,这是什么原因呢: <?php echo date('Y-m-d H:i:s'); ?〉 输出当前时间:2008-10-12 02:32:17 怪了,实际时间是:2008-10-12 10:32:17 难道是PHP的date()时间不正确 少8个小时? 再看看PHP手册的“例子 1. date() 例子”第一行多了一个 时区设置 // 设定要用的默认时区...
PHP 2014-12-02 01:01:14 -
php 使用$_SERVER获取当前完整url的写法
本文是一个php实现的使用$_SERVER获取当前完整url的示例代码,感兴趣的同学参考下. "http://".$_SERVER ['HTTP_HOST'].$_SERVER['PHP_SELF']."?".$_SERVER['QUERY_STRING']; php server函数 大全 SERVER["HTTP_ACCEPT"]=*/* $_SERVER["HTTP_REFERER"]=http://localhost/lianxi/ $_SERVER["HTTP_ACCEPT_LANGUAGE"]=zh-cn $_SERVER["HTTP_ACCEPT_ENCODING"]=gzip, deflate $_SERVER["HTTP_USER_AGENT"]=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.2; .NE...
PHP 2014-11-30 14:25:25 -
MYSQL获取当前时间函数
本文为大家讲解了一个mysql数据库获取当前日期时间的函数:now(),感兴趣的同学参考下. NOW()函数以`'YYYY-MM-DD HH:MM:SS'返回当前的日期时间,可以直接存到DATETIME字段中。 CURDATE()以'YYYY-MM-DD'的格式返回今天的日期,可以直接存到DATE字段中...
数据库操作教程 2014-11-30 06:19:44 -
Smarty 获取当前日期时间和格式化日期时间的方法
本文为大家讲解的是如何使用Smarty 获取当前日期时间和格式化日期时间的方法,感兴趣的同学参考下。 在Smarty 中获取当前日期时间和格式化日期时间与PHP中有些不同的地方,这里就为您详细介绍: 首先是获取当前的日期时间: 在PHP中我们会使用date函数来获取当前的时间,实例代码如下: date("Y-m-dH:i:s"); //该结果会显示为:2010-07-27 21:19:36 的模式 但是在Smarty 模板中我们就不能使用date 了,而是应该使用 now 来获取当前的时间,实例代码如下: {$smarty.now} //该结果会显示为:1280236776的时间戳模式 然而我们还可以将这个时间戳格式化,实例代码如下: {$smarty.now|date_format:'%Y-%m-%d %H:%M:%S'} //该结果会显示为 2010-07-27 21:19:36 的时间模式 需要说明的...
PHP 2014-11-29 07:47:50